#030cbc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#030cbc is composed of 1.2% red, 4.7%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.4% cyan, 93.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 237.1 degrees, a saturation of 96.9% and a lightness of 37.5%. #030cbc color hex could be obtained by blending #0618ff with #000079.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

#030cbc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#030cbc has RGB values of R:3, G:12,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 199868.
